MSFX says

Wow you’re loving the green considering your avatar is blue lol…

Whats the purpose of the site? If its for bringing in clients then perhaps having links to free files and featured authors on a stock site is not such a smart idea since they may end up going elsewhere with the work… just a thought.

Realise what you want from the site whilst considering what to include / exclude… don’t be afraid to not follow trends (i.e. having every piece of social media mashed together on a page) :)
